Coleus Plant / Redhead Coleus : Keep the soil slightly moist when the plant is actively growing, but drier conditions in winter months.
They need to be kept moist, especially newly planted coleus. Coleus can be one of your first stops for those who are on the search for shade loving annuals. Grown primarily for its foliage, coleus can add a nice accent to other flowering annuals and perennials, or can often be used in large landscape plantings entirely on its own for a grand effect.
